Types of Jackpot Systems: A Comparative Analysis

Online casinos employ a variety of jackpot systems,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. A thorough understanding of these types is essential for evaluating their effectiveness and impact on the bottom line. The most common categories include:

  • Standalone Jackpots: These are the simplest type, where the jackpot is specific to a single game and funded by a percentage of the bets placed on that game. The prize pool accumulates independently, offering a relatively contained risk profile for the casino.
  • Local Area Network (LAN) Jackpots: These jackpots link multiple machines or games within a single casino or across a network of affiliated sites. The prize pool grows faster, attracting more players and generating higher levels of excitement. However, this also increases the financial exposure for the operator.
  • Wide Area Network (WAN) Jackpots: The most lucrative type, WAN jackpots connect games across multiple casinos, often across different jurisdictions. These jackpots can reach astronomical sums, generating significant media attention and player interest. The risk is substantial, requiring robust risk management strategies and sophisticated financial modeling.
  • Progressive Jackpots: This is a common feature across all jackpot types. The jackpot amount increases incrementally with each bet placed on the participating games, until a lucky player wins. The rate of increase is determined by the game’s configuration and the percentage of each bet contributed to the jackpot.
  • Fixed Jackpots: These jackpots offer a predetermined prize amount, regardless of player participation. While less exciting than progressive jackpots, they provide a more predictable payout structure and can be useful for attracting players to specific games.

The Mechanics of Jackpot Implementation

Implementing a successful jackpot system involves several critical considerations. These include:

  • Selección de juegos: Choosing the right games to feature jackpots is crucial. Popular, high-volatility games are often preferred, as they generate more bets and contribute more quickly to the jackpot pool.
  • Contribution Rate: Determining the percentage of each bet that goes towards the jackpot is a delicate balancing act. A higher contribution rate leads to faster jackpot growth but can also impact the game’s overall return to player (RTP).
  • Triggering Mechanisms: The method for triggering a jackpot win must be carefully designed to ensure fairness and randomness. Common methods include random number generators (RNGs), bonus rounds, or specific symbol combinations.
  • Payout Structure: Deciding how the jackpot will be paid out is another important consideration. Options include lump-sum payments, annuity payments, or tiered jackpot structures.
  • Risk Management: Implementing robust risk management strategies is essential to protect the casino from excessive payouts. This includes setting maximum jackpot limits, monitoring jackpot growth, and using insurance to mitigate potential losses.

Analyzing Jackpot Performance: Key Metrics and KPIs

To effectively evaluate the performance of a jackpot system, analysts must track a range of key performance indicators (KPIs). These include:

  • Jackpot Contribution Rate: The percentage of each bet that contributes to the jackpot.
  • Jackpot Win Frequency: The average time between jackpot wins.
  • Average Jackpot Payout: The average amount paid out per jackpot win.
  • Return to Player (RTP): The overall RTP of the game, including the jackpot contribution.
  • Player Engagement Metrics: Measuring player activity, such as average session duration, bet frequency, and player retention rates.
  • Revenue Generation: Tracking the impact of the jackpot system on overall casino revenue.

Forecasting and Risk Assessment

Accurate forecasting and risk assessment are vital for managing jackpot systems effectively. This involves:

  • Modeling Jackpot Growth: Using statistical models to predict the rate of jackpot growth based on player activity, contribution rates, and win frequencies.
  • Assessing Jackpot Risk: Evaluating the potential financial exposure of the casino, considering factors such as jackpot size, win frequency, and player concentration.
  • Developing Contingency Plans: Preparing for the possibility of large jackpot payouts, including securing insurance and establishing payout procedures.
